Common Causes of Button Malfunctions
- Accumulation of dirt, dust, or debris around the button
- Physical damage from drops or impacts
- Worn-out or broken internal components
- Software glitches affecting button response
- Corrosion or water damage
Simple Fixes for Faulty Buttons
Many button issues can be resolved with some basic troubleshooting and repair techniques. Here are some practical steps you can take:
Cleaning the Buttons
Use a soft brush or compressed air to remove dirt and debris from around the buttons. Dabbing a small amount of isopropyl alcohol on a cloth can help clean the contacts and improve responsiveness.
Checking for Software Issues
Restart your device or perform a software update. Sometimes, button malfunctions are caused by glitches that can be fixed with simple resets or updates.
Performing a Factory Reset
If software issues persist, consider backing up your data and performing a factory reset. This can resolve underlying software conflicts affecting button performance.
When to Seek Professional Repairs
If cleaning and software fixes do not resolve the issue, it may be time to consult a professional technician. Faulty internal components or physical damage often require specialized tools and skills to repair. Professional repairs can restore your device’s functionality and preserve its value.
Preparing Your Phone for Sale or Trade
- Ensure all buttons are responsive and functioning properly.
- Clean the device thoroughly, including the buttons and ports.
- Back up your data and perform a factory reset to protect your privacy.
- Gather all accessories, original packaging, and receipts if available.
- Take clear, high-quality photos showcasing the device’s condition.
